出 处:《水运工程》2023年第8期224-230,共7页Port & Waterway Engineering
摘 要:针对引江济淮工程J002-1标段护岸软体排出现的预制块挤压破损、施工效率低下等问题,对原设计方案护岸软体排结构以及施工方法进行优化。通过参考工程实例以及方案比选,采用C25混凝土预制块联锁片软体排结构和铺排船施工的方法。结果表明,优化施工方案技术上可行,预制块破损少、施工效率高,达到预期效果。软体排结构优化和铺排船施工工法在引江济淮工程的成功应用,为类似工程提供良好示范,具有较好的推广应用价值。Regarding the problems such as extrusion damage of prefabricated blocks and low construction efficiency in the soft mattress for bank revetment of J002-1 section of the Yangtze River to Huaihe River diversion project,we optimize the original design scheme of soft mattress structure for bank revetment and construction method.We adopt the soft mattress structure of C25 concrete prefabricated blocks interlock sheet and the construction method of geotextiles-laying boat by referring to engineering examples and scheme comparison and selection.The results show that the optimized construction scheme is technically feasible,the prefabricated blocks have the advantages of less damaged and high construction efficiency,and the expected effect is achieved.The successful application of soft mattress structure optimization and geotextiles-laying boat construction method in the Yangtze River to Huaihe River diversion project provides a good demonstration for similar projects and has good popularization and application value.
关 键 词:护岸软体排 铺排船 结构优化 工法改进 引江济淮工程
